Mastercard and Norwegian financialtechnology (FinTech) company EedenBull have agreed to expand their partnership to the Asia Pacific region, the firms announced Monday (June 29). Under the terms of the new deal, Mastercard will support EedenBull’s product development and digital services.

As evidence that sandboxes are ever-increasingly a global phenomenon, Kuwait’s central bank put forth guidelines this week that are geared toward companies seeking to meld financialtechnology (FinTech) and financial services (FinServ). The sandbox, Reuters reported, has four phases.
Look Who’s Charging is integrated with a number of Australian banks, with data available to millions of Australians within its existing digitalbanking apps. And Experian Australia & New Zealand announced that it has acquired FinTech Look Who’s Charging.
